Campaign launched at uninsured drivers

The UK Motor Insurers Bureau has launched a new campaign to drive home the message to uninsured drivers, the importance of having vehicle insurance.

The campaign, named "Stay Insured", will be launched with the theme that you cannot afford to stay uninsured. Harsher penalties are being put in place to target the thousands of uninsured drivers, who each year cause accidents costing tax payers money and increasing the average insurance policy by £30. Also targeting the uninsured has become much easier for the police forces who want to crack down on the law breakers.

Stay insured will mainly be targeted at young drivers who need to understand the dangers that they are causing to pedestrians and other drivers, not just to themselves. More than one third of the uninsured drivers on UK roads are under the age of 30 and due to their lack of experience they are the most likely to make claims on their insurance policies, so without insurance they are a real risk. £380 million in compensation was paid out last year by the motor Insurers Bureau who deal with accident claims caused by uninsured drivers.
